Job Description

Tasks



Assemble and fasten materials to make framework or props, using hand tools and wood screws, nails, dowel pins, or glue; Build or repair cabinets, doors, frameworks, floors, and other wooden fixtures used in buildings, using woodworking machines, carpenter's hand tools, and power tools; Follow established safety rules, policies and regulations and maintain a safe and clean environment; Inspect ceiling or floor tile, wall coverings, siding, glass, or woodwork to detect broken or damaged structures; Install structures and fixtures, such as windows, frames, floorings, and trim, or hardware, using carpenter's hand and power tools; Measure and mark cutting lines on materials, using ruler, pencil, chalk, and marking gauge; Remove damaged or defective parts or sections of structures and repair or replace, using tools; Shape or cut materials to specified measurements, using hand tools, machines, or power saw; o Study specifications in blueprints, sketches or building plans to prepare project layout and determine dimensions and materials required; Verify trueness of structure, using lasers and levels. Install pressure treated decks and fence materials using hand tools and power tools. o install, repair or replace wall coverings such as gypsum board. Plastering and painting a variety of wall coverings using the appropriate compound for the material being used. Minor electrical changes such as removing or relocating an end device such as a switch, plug or light fixture Minor plumbing changes such as removing or relocating vanity, toilet, etc. Replacing old damaged water lines with new. Install a variety of floor coverings such laminate, hardwood, linoleum, vinyl plank, etc.

Qualifications and requirements



A diploma in carpentry from a recognized vocational school; Ability to use logic and reason to identify the strengths and weaknesses of alternative solutions; Ability to determine the kind of tools and equipment needed to do a job and to monitor gauges, dials, or other indicators to make sure a machine is working properly.
